
移动应用程序(APP)的快速发展,使得开发APP的技术变得越来越重要。随着市场的激烈竞争,开发者们迫切需要掌握最佳的技术来提供卓越的用户体验。本文将介绍一些最好的开发APP技术,帮助开发者们在激烈的市场竞争中脱颖而出。
1. 响应式设计技术:
响应式设计技术是开发APP时必不可少的技术之一。随着不同类型的移动设备和屏幕尺寸的增多,一个APP在各种设备上都能提供一致的用户体验,成为了用户的追求。使用响应式设计技术,开发者能够自动适应不同屏幕尺寸,确保APP的布局和功能在不同设备上都能完美展示。这种技术的应用可以大大提高用户对APP的满意度。
2. 云技术:
云技术在开发APP过程中也发挥着重要的作用。通过使用云技术,开发者可以将APP的数据存储在云端,使用户可以随时随地访问和同步数据。这种技术不仅提高了APP的可靠性,还可以降低开发和维护的成本。云技术还能提供更快的数据传输速度和更好的安全性,确保用户数据的保密性。
3. 人工智能技术:
人工智能技术的应用正在改变着开发APP的方式。通过集成人工智能技术,APP能够更好地与用户进行交互,并根据用户的行为和偏好提供个性化的服务。APP可以通过分析用户的历史数据,向用户推荐符合其兴趣的内容。人工智能技术的引入,不仅可以提升用户体验,还可以提高APP的用户留存率和市场竞争力。
4. 跨平台开发技术:
随着多种操作系统和平台的兴起,开发者们需要寻找一种能够在不同平台上运行的技术。跨平台开发技术应运而生。通过使用跨平台开发技术,开发者可以同时开发适用于不同操作系统的APP。这一技术不仅能够减少开发时间和成本,还能够保持APP在不同平台上的一致性。
5. 物联网技术:
随着物联网的兴起,APP与物联网设备之间的互联互通变得越来越重要。开发者可以利用物联网技术将APP与各种智能设备相连接,实现智能家居、智能健康监测等功能。通过与物联网设备的互联互通,APP能够提供更加便捷和智能的服务。物联网技术的应用将成为开发APP的未来趋势。
开发APP的最好技术是多种技术的综合运用。通过使用响应式设计技术、云技术、人工智能技术、跨平台开发技术和物联网技术,开发者能够为用户提供卓越的体验和功能。这些技术的应用将使得APP能够在市场竞争中脱颖而出,赢得更多用户的喜爱和认可。作为开发者,掌握这些技术将有助于提高开发效率,增加APP的价值。
开发APP最好的技术方法

随着智能手机的普及和移动互联网的快速发展,APP已成为人们生活中必不可少的一部分。APP的开发技术方法直接影响着用户体验和产品品质。本文将介绍一些开发APP最好的技术方法,旨在帮助开发者更好地理解和应用技术,提升APP的性能和用户满意度。
一、采用跨平台开发技术
随着移动互联网的不断发展,不同的操作系统和设备数量繁多,如何在多个平台上开发和发布APP成为了开发者面临的挑战。跨平台开发技术可以帮助开发者在多个平台上共用代码,减少开发成本和时间。Ionic、React Native和Flutter等跨平台开发框架日益流行,它们具有良好的性能和用户体验,是开发APP的较好选择。
二、优化APP的性能
用户对于APP的响应速度和流畅度有较高的要求,因此优化APP的性能显得尤为重要。开发者可以采用懒加载和预加载技术,将不必要的资源延迟加载或预先加载,提高APP的启动速度和页面加载速度。合理使用缓存机制,如图片、数据等,可有效减少数据请求和加载时间,提升用户体验。减少APP的内存占用和功耗,也是优化性能的重要手段。
三、充分利用云服务
随着云计算的普及,云服务为APP的开发提供了更多的便利和可能性。通过将一些计算和存储任务外包给云服务提供商,可以有效减少APP的资源占用和开发成本。云服务还可以提供更强大的数据分析和处理能力,帮助开发者更好地理解用户需求和行为,优化APP的功能和设计。
四、保障APP的安全性
随着APP数量的增加和用户数量的增长,APP的安全性问题日益凸显。为了保护用户的个人信息和隐私,开发者需要采取一系列的安全措施。加密通信是保障APP安全性的基本要求,使用SSL/TLS等协议加密数据传输,可有效防止信息被篡改或泄露。APP的代码和逻辑也需要进行安全审查和漏洞检测,及时修复潜在的安全隐患。
五、持续优化和迭代
APP开发不是一次性的工作,随着技术的不断进步和用户需求的变化,持续优化和迭代是保持APP竞争力的关键。开发者可以通过用户反馈、数据分析以及市场竞争情况等来持续改进APP的功能和性能,提供更好的用户体验。及时更新和修复BUG,发布新版本,也是保持用户满意度的重要手段。
开发APP最好的技术方法包括采用跨平台开发技术、优化APP的性能、充分利用云服务、保障APP的安全性以及持续优化和迭代。开发者可以根据自身需求和行业特点选取合适的技术方法,并结合用户反馈和市场情况不断改进和完善APP,提供更好的用户体验和服务。只有不断追求创新和优化,才能在激烈的市场竞争中脱颖而出,取得成功。
开发APP最好的技术是什么

随着智能手机的普及和移动互联网的快速发展,APP已经成为了人们生活中不可或缺的一部分。在开发APP的过程中,选择合适的技术方案是非常关键的。本文将介绍几种常见的APP开发技术,并对它们进行比较和评价,以期为读者提供一些有益的参考。
一、原生开发技术
原生开发技术是指使用各平台提供的开发语言和工具进行APP开发。iOS平台使用Objective-C或Swift,Android平台使用Java或Kotlin。原生开发技术具有良好的性能和稳定性,能够充分利用平台的功能和特性。由于需要编写不同平台的代码,并且学习成本较高,原生开发技术在开发周期和成本方面存在一定的缺陷。
二、混合开发技术
混合开发技术是指将HTML、CSS和JavaScript等Web技术与原生开发技术结合起来,通过WebView展示内容并与原生代码进行交互。混合开发技术具有较低的开发成本和快速的开发周期,同时可以跨平台使用。由于性能和用户体验方面的限制,混合开发技术在复杂的APP开发中可能显得力不从心。
三、跨平台开发技术
跨平台开发技术是指使用一种统一的开发语言和工具,通过编译器将代码转换为不同平台的原生代码。常见的跨平台开发技术包括React Native和Flutter等。跨平台开发技术具有较低的开发成本和快速的开发周期,同时能够实现接近原生开发的性能和用户体验。由于跨平台技术本身的限制,一些平台特定的功能和特性无法完全支持。
每一种APP开发技术都有其优势和限制。对于开发人员来说,根据项目的需求和要求选择合适的技术方案是至关重要的。如果追求最高的性能和稳定性,并且有足够的资源和时间,原生开发技术是最好的选择。如果追求较低的成本和快速的开发周期,并且对性能要求不是特别高,混合开发技术是一个不错的选择。而对于需要跨平台开发,并且注重开发效率和用户体验的项目,跨平台开发技术是一个不错的选择。
随着技术的不断进步和发展,APP开发技术也将不断演变和完善。无论使用何种技术,最重要的是紧跟技术的发展潮流,不断学习和更新自己的知识,以适应不断变化的市场需求。才能在激烈的竞争中脱颖而出,开发出更加优秀的APP作品。(493字)